Innyakh (; ) is a rural locality (a selo) in Delgeysky Rural Okrug of Olyokminsky District in the Sakha Republic, Russia, located from Olyokminsk, the administrative center of the district and from Delgey, the administrative center of the rural okrug. Its population as of the 2002 Census was 118.
